Since Melissa hit the Press, other variants from 'ILoveYou' to 'AnnaKournikova' to 'SouthPark' to 'Klez' has found its way through the net causing untold damage.Recently, the Blaster virus proves that e-mail is not the only way to deliver viruses over the internet. Bugbear could cripple your hard drive and the writer(s) of this virus could comprimise your personal security. SoBig is the one where an admin might say you account is coming up for expiry. Dumaru is the one where someone claims to be a Microsoft security person mailing you a fix patch.
NOTE: ALL Microsoft fixes are done via the Windows Update feature.

The ONLY way to fight back is to keep your anti-virus programme updated at least daily. Whatever Antivirus Program you are using, it is vital that you configure your settings properly so that you are protected from viruses. For example, with AVG antivirus, you should configure the settings to update for new virus definitions daily. Because ther are so many new viruses coming out, your Antivirus program needs to be configured to get the latest protection on a daily basis. There are several anti-virus programmes out there:
For Norton Anti-Virus, there is a programme called Live Update that keep your Norton Anti-Virus programme and other Norton Programmes up to date. For AVG antivirus, make sure that your settings are set up as follows: In the bottom, right hand screen of your computer, double-click on the AVG icon. Click on the "Update Manager" tab. In the "Allow Scheduled Updates" field, select "Update if database older than one (1) days". "If not successfull, then repeat in one (1) days". By configuring these settings as instructed, your Antivirus program will automatically check for new virus protection on a daily basis, and you will be protected from the latest viruses.
